Dekalb Podcasts

Hillcrest Covenant Church DeKalb artwork

Hillcrest Covenant Church DeKalb

220 episodes - Latest episode: 3 days ago - ★★★★★ - 8 ratings
Weekly sermons from Hillcrest Covenant Church in DeKalb, IL. 
Related Dekalb Topics